Output 42f618063d174b50013bcf07754194a610f9a7ecfab486b698c541fe078319ea:0

value
30853745
script pubkey
OP_0 OP_PUSHBYTES_32 8ef59745344e82d8a0f222a4d52794180774c3d3d6a3277c3c3d4fceeb3db402
address
bc1q3m6ew3f5f6pd3g8jy2jd2fu5rqrhfs7n663jwlpu848ua6eakspqxqzls3
transaction
42f618063d174b50013bcf07754194a610f9a7ecfab486b698c541fe078319ea
spent
true